Everything You Need to Know About Microneedling

Microneedling, often referred to as collagen induction therapy, is gaining popularity for its effectiveness in treating various skin concerns. This minimally invasive treatment promises rejuvenation by recruiting your body’s own healing powers. Here's what you should know about microneedling and why it might be the right choice for your skin.


Microneedling involves using a device equipped with fine needles to create thousands of tiny, invisible puncture wounds in the top layer of skin. This process stimulates the body’s natural wound healing processes, resulting in cellular turnover and increased collagen and elastin production.

Benefits of Microneedling

  • The natural ageing process can be gracefully slowed down as new collagen fills in fine lines and wrinkles.

  • Microneedling is proven to diminish the look of surgery and acne scars.

  • Regular treatments can make your skin smoother and more uniform in tone.

  • It can also reduce the size of your pores by stimulating collagen in and around your pores.


The frequency of treatments can vary depending on your specific skin concerns and goals. Typically, it is recommended to have 4-6 sessions, spaced about a month apart.


During the procedure, you will feel a mild scratching sensation, which is generally not painful. Post-treatment, you may notice redness and mild swelling for a few days.
